10 Tips for a Successful Online Dating Profile Photoshoot

1. Define Your Goals and Style

Decide what you want your photos to convey-confidence, approachability, playfulness, or sophistication. Think about what aspects of your personality you want to highlight and communicate this to your photographer so they can tailor the shoot to your vision

2. Choose the Right Photographer

Select a photographer who specializes in dating profile photos or lifestyle portraits. Review their portfolio to ensure they capture personality and authenticity, not just polished images. A photographer who helps you feel comfortable will bring out your best self.

3. Plan Your Outfits

Pick outfits that make you feel confident and comfortable. Aim for a mix of casual and dressy looks to show different sides of yourself. Solid colors or subtle patterns work best and won’t distract from your face. Add accessories for a personal touch, but don’t let them overwhelm your look.

4. Prepare Your Appearance

Take care of grooming details: clean and trim your nails, style your hair, and keep makeup natural to avoid an overproduced look. The goal is to look like the best version of yourself, not someone else

5. Select Meaningful Locations

Choose locations that reflect your interests and personality, such as a favorite park, a cozy café, or a vibrant city street. Good lighting is essential-natural light is often most flattering. The setting should add depth to your photos and tell a bit of your story

6.Mix Up Your Shots

Include a variety of photos: close-ups, full-body shots, and candid moments. Activity shots-like walking your dog or enjoying a hobby-make you look more approachable and genuine. Avoid business headshots or overly posed images

7. Practice Natural Poses

Work with your photographer to find poses that feel relaxed and natural. Angle your body slightly, lean toward the camera, and experiment with different facial expressions. A genuine smile is more inviting than a forced one-think of something that makes you happy to bring out a real smile

8. Show Your Face Clearly

Make sure your face is visible in most shots-avoid hats, sunglasses, or anything that obscures your features. Potential matches want to see your eyes and smile, which help build trust and connection.

9. Prioritize Authenticity

Use recent photos that accurately represent how you look today. Avoid heavy filters or editing that change your appearance. Authenticity is key to attracting matches who are interested in the real you.

10. Curate and Update Your Profile

Select a handful of the best photos that showcase different aspects of your personality and lifestyle. Refresh your images every few months or after a significant change in appearance. A well-rounded, up-to-date profile keeps your online presence engaging and trustworthy.

By following these steps, you’ll create a compelling, authentic online dating profile that stands out and attracts meaningful connections.
